Job Description Summary
The Executive Director will have the responsibility for and authority to manage all aspects of the SRALAB at the Partnership location including the The Executive Director will have the responsibility for and authority to manage all aspects of the SRALAB at the Partnership location including the management direction of all management staff, rehabilitation nursing staff and allied health staff assigned to the PM&R Program, in partnership with the Medical Director. The Executive Director will be an employee of SRALAB and function with the Medical Director as a self-managed team. The Executive Director will report directly to the Vice President, Strategic Alliances, and will have accountability to certain other administrative/executive representatives of SRALAB and the partnership. In addition, the Executive Director will be accountable to the Oversight/Governing Committee of the SRALAB Partnership.Job Description
The Executive Director will:
Together with Medical Director, oversees all activities of the PM&R Program.
Leadership in extensive program development for acute medical/surgical, inpatient acute, outpatient, any future services of the partnership;
Budget development and variance analysis
Management of financial and material resources within the approved budget;
Ensuring Program compliance with regularity and accrediting agencies;
Monitoring and analyzing financial operations and devising proactive strategies to ensure favorable financial performance;
Development, implementation and management of referral promotion and marketing plan, specific to SRALAB at the Partnership;
Successful collaboration with and leadership of the relationship with Alliance Health System.
Selection and management selection of key staff for each service line level of care; programs, and sites of care;
Identification of appropriate skill mix and staffing plans for each service line, program, and site of care;
Education of allied health staff;
Staff development and performance evaluation
Perform all other duties that may be assigned in the best interest of SRALAB.
The Executive Director will work in concert with the Medical Director to design, implement, and operate the following:
A high-quality and cost efficient Program;
Standards of quality and budgetary performance consistent with SRALAB and Partnership standards;
A Program responsible to the needs of the community and payers;
Staffing levels/ratios consistent with the SRALAB and Partnership standards of care and operational expectations.
Liaison and communication functions within service and among the several service lines/levels of rehabilitation care;
SRALAB and Partnership organizational collaboration and integration.
Reporting Relationships:
Reports directly to the SRAlab Vice President, Strategic Alliances and to the Partnership Executive Designee.
